Jacksonville, Florida, captivates visitors with its expansive coastline and vibrant arts scene. The city is home to the beautiful Jacksonville Beach, ideal for sunbathing and surfing, and Riverside Avondale Historic District, perfect for those interested in heritage and architecture. Adventure seekers can explore the Timucuan Ecological and Historic Preserve for hiking and kayaking. The city hosts numerous festivals and sporting events, ensuring year-round entertainment. Dining here is diverse, with seafood delicacies being a highlight. Jacksonville's diverse neighborhoods, arts scene, and outdoor activities promise a fulfilling experience for all visitors.

Jacksonville Safety Information

Overall Safety Rating

Moderate Risk

Exercise standard precautions.

Local Laws

Travelers should be aware of local laws regarding alcohol consumption and public behavior.

Crime Rates

Jacksonville has a moderate crime rate with higher incidents of property crime compared to violent crime. Petty theft and burglary are more common in certain areas.

Health Risks

Healthcare facilities are widely available in Jacksonville, with no significant health risks beyond standard urban concerns.

Natural Disasters

Jacksonville is susceptible to hurricanes and tropical storms, particularly during the Atlantic hurricane season from June to November.

Law Enforcement

The Jacksonville Sheriff's Office is visible and active in the community, with efforts to engage with residents and tourists to ensure safety.

Public Transportation

Public transportation in Jacksonville is generally safe, but travelers should remain vigilant, especially at night.

Solo Travelers

Solo travelers should take standard precautions to ensure their safety while exploring Jacksonville.

Recent Developments

There have been recent initiatives to improve community policing and reduce crime rates in high-crime areas.

Best Time to Visit Jacksonville

Summary: The best time to visit Jacksonville is during the spring (March to May) and fall (September to November) months when temperatures are mild, ranging from 18°C to 27°C (65°F to 80°F). These seasons showcase vibrant events, making them perfect for exploration.

❄️

January

Cool temperatures between 8°C and 18°C (46°F to 65°F), ideal for exploring the city's parks. Enjoy the Jacksonville Boat Show.

💘

February

Mild weather with temperatures from 50°F to 68°F (10°C to 20°C). Great for outdoor festivals like the SeaBest Seafood Festival.

🌱

March

Best

Spring flowers bloom, with temperatures between 13°C and 23°C (55°F to 73°F). Attend the Jacksonville Jazz Festival.

🌸

April

Best

Warm weather of 61°F to 79°F (16°C to 26°C), ideal for beach visits and the World of Nations Celebration.

🌷

May

Best

Pleasant temperatures ranging from 66°F to 82°F (19°C to 28°C). Enjoy the Jacksonville Film Festival.

☀️

June

Hotter days with temperatures from 72°F to 88°F (22°C to 31°C), perfect for beach activities. Explore the Summer Music Festival.

🏖️

July

Hot and humid, with highs around 33°C (91°F). Enjoy Independence Day festivities and water sports.

🌞

August

Warm and humid, with temperatures between 23°C and 33°C (74°F to 91°F). Great for beach and water activities.

🍂

September

Best

End of summer with cooler temps from 70°F to 86°F (21°C to 30°C). Attend the Jacksonville Sea & Sky Air Show.

🍁

October

Best

Pleasant fall weather with temperatures around 62°F to 81°F (17°C to 27°C). Visit during the Fall at the Jacksonville Fair.

November

Best

Mild autumn temperatures ranging from 54°F to 72°F (12°C to 22°C). Enjoy the Jacksonville PorchFest.

🎄

December

Cooler winter month with temperatures from 46°F to 66°F (8°C to 19°C). Holiday events and decorations abound.

Popular Foods in Jacksonville

Mayport Shrimp

Locally sourced, fresh shrimp from the nearby fishing village of Mayport.

Minorcan Clam Chowder

A unique tomato-based clam chowder with a spicy kick, influenced by the local Minorcan culture.

Datil Pepper Sauce

A spicy and tangy sauce made from datil peppers, cherished by locals.

Fried Alligator

A Southern delicacy, often served as an appetizer or in tacos.

Gritz & Gravy

A comforting Southern dish combining cheesy grits with rich gravy.

Popular Trip Types

Family Vacation Icon

Family Vacation

Jacksonville, Florida, offers a variety of family-friendly attractions, including the Jacksonville Zoo and Gardens, MOSH (Museum of Science and History), and Adventure Landing amusement park. The city's extensive park system and family-friendly beaches provide endless outdoor recreation options that cater to visitors of all ages.

Beach Getaway

With miles of beautiful coastline, Jacksonville is an ideal destination for a beach getaway. Visitors can relax on pristine beaches such as Jacksonville Beach, Neptune Beach, and Little Talbot Island State Park, offering activities like swimming, sunbathing, and watersports.

Golf Retreat

Jacksonville is a haven for golf enthusiasts, featuring numerous high-quality golf courses, including the renowned TPC Sawgrass. The city's favorable climate and beautiful landscapes make it an excellent destination for a golf retreat, offering challenging courses for all skill levels.

Cultural Exploration Icon

Cultural Exploration

Rich in history and culture, Jacksonville is home to several museums and historical sites, including the Cummer Museum of Art and Gardens and the Kingsley Plantation. The city's vibrant arts scene, with frequent festivals and events, provides ample opportunities for cultural exploration.

Fishing and Boating Excursion

Located along the St. Johns River and the Atlantic Ocean, Jacksonville offers excellent opportunities for fishing and boating. Whether it's deep-sea fishing, river tours, or kayaking through the city's waterways, Jacksonville is a prime location for those looking to enjoy water-based activities.

Custom Language

The River City

Jacksonville

Locals often refer to Jacksonville as The River City, denoting its connection to the St. Johns River.

Jax

Jacksonville

A common abbreviation used informally to refer to the city.

Duval

Cheer

A chant used by Jacksonville Jaguars fans, referring to Duval County.

904

Area code

Refers to the area code for Jacksonville, often used to denote local pride.

Bold City

Nicknamed

A nickname reflecting the bold spirit and history of Jacksonville.

Popular Sports & Teams in Jacksonville

Jacksonville Jaguars

The Jacksonville Jaguars are a professional American football team based in Jacksonville, Florida. They compete in the National Football League (NFL) as a member club of the league's American Football Conference (AFC) South division.

Jacksonville Jaguars Official Website

Jacksonville Jumbo Shrimp

The Jacksonville Jumbo Shrimp are a Minor League Baseball team and the Triple-A affiliate of the Miami Marlins. They play in the International League.

Jacksonville Jumbo Shrimp Official Website

Jacksonville Icemen

The Jacksonville Icemen are a professional ice hockey team in the ECHL. They are affiliated with the NHL's New York Rangers and the AHL's Hartford Wolf Pack.

Jacksonville Icemen Official Website

North Florida Ospreys

The North Florida Ospreys represent the University of North Florida in NCAA Division I athletics. They are a member of the ASUN Conference.

North Florida Ospreys Official Website

Jacksonville Armada FC

The Jacksonville Armada FC is a soccer team based in Jacksonville, Florida. They previously competed in the North American Soccer League (NASL) and now compete in the National Premier Soccer League (NPSL).

Unique customs/traditions

Gator Bowl

An annual college football bowl game, a New Year's Day tradition in Jacksonville.

River Run

An annual 15K race that draws runners from around the world through the city's beautiful routes.

Art Walk

A monthly event that transforms downtown streets into a lively cultural showcase.

Historic Springfield Tour of Homes

An annual event where historic homes open their doors for tours.

Jax Ale Trail

A trail connecting several local craft breweries, showcasing Jacksonville's beer culture.
